Thread Mill 「AT-1」English version Evolution from conventional 2-pass cutting to 1-pass cutting by preventing bending, thus reducing cutting time
Conventional thread mills often require several passes to generate a thread. The AT-1’s revolutionary capability to generate threads in one pass lies in its unique tool geometry. The unequal spacing and variable lead flute of the AT-1 minimizes vibration, thereby enables superior and consistent surface finish.
Conventional right-hand helix thread mill is prone to deflection as the cutting process begins from the tip. In contrast, a first of its kind with a patent in Japan in the thread mill category, the AT-1’s right-hand cut and left-hand helix geometry begins the cutting process from the shank side, thereby reduces deflection. With the elimination of zero-cutting, which is used for the correction of deflection, longer tool life can be achieved.

Understanding CNC Thread Milling Technology
Thread milling is a machining process that uses a rotating cutting tool to generate threads through a controlled helical motion. Unlike tapping, which forms threads in a single pass, thread milling allows gradual material removal with exceptional control over thread geometry. A thread mill cutter for CNC machines follows a programmed toolpath, enabling precise adjustment of thread diameter, pitch, and depth. This flexibility makes thread milling ideal for complex components, thin-walled parts, and high-value workpieces where accuracy is critical. Because the cutting forces are lower and more evenly distributed, CNC thread milling reduces the risk of tool breakage and part damage, even at high machining speeds.

Key Advantages of Using Thread Mill Cutters for CNC
One major benefit is versatility. A single thread mill cutter for metal can often be used to produce threads of different diameters with the same pitch, simply by adjusting the CNC program. This reduces the need for multiple taps and lowers inventory costs. Another advantage is precision. Thread milling offers superior control over thread depth and profile, resulting in high-quality threads with excellent surface finish. This is especially important for critical assemblies where thread accuracy affects performance and safety. Thread milling also enhances process reliability. In the event of tool wear or breakage, the tool can be safely removed without damaging the workpiece, unlike broken taps that are difficult to extract.

Maximizing Your Treadmill Running
Treadmill running helps avoid the heat, but is the workout as good?
There’s a reason runners refer to the treadmill as the “dreadmill.” The exercise machine provides limited visual stimuli and is typically located in a gym or basement, which can be a stuffy, uninviting place to run. Clocking mile after mile in the same place, especially for a long run, can mean an hour or more of boredom.
There are, however, benefits to running on the treadmill, running coaches and exercise scientists say. The record-breaking temperatures and the poor air quality from the Canadian wildfires this year have made running outside risky or outright dangerous at times. Treadmills allow runners to keep training despite inclement or hot weather.
“Treadmills are misunderstood by a vast majority of the people,” said James McKirdy, a running coach. “Having that option is important and can be pivotal in the success of someone’s goals.”
We asked running experts about the effectiveness of treadmill running and how to get the most out of those workouts.
Is running on the treadmill as effective as running outside?
There are subtle differences with running on the treadmill, but it is largely as effective as training outside, experts say.
While energy consumption is “very, very slightly lower,” in treadmill running, the differences are minor, said Bas Van Hooren, a competitive runner and researcher at Maastricht University in the Netherlands. At speeds of up to 16 kilometers per hour, which is roughly a six-minute per mile pace, treadmill running results in similar oxygen costs and heart rate compared to outside running, he said.
The slight difference in energy consumption, though, can add up if you do the majority or all of your training on a treadmill, Van Hooren added.
The treadmills themselves may also have limitations. Some can only go up to a certain speed, and others, whether because of quality or wear and tear, can display inaccurate paces on the screen, McKirdy said.
Do I have to use the incline?
Some runners put treadmills at a 1 percent incline in an effort to match the energy costs of running outdoors, but that isn’t necessary, said Van Hooren, who has been a co-author on reviews on treadmill running. Keeping your treadmill at a zero percent incline is fine.
Increasing the incline on treadmills can be useful, though, for hill repeats or to mix up your workouts.
“Hill workouts might be easier on treadmills, because if you’re doing it outside, it might take a long time to get down the hill,” said Olympian Kim Conley, a running coach. “But on a treadmill, you can go as long as you want or short as you want on your recovery.”
How does the treadmill affect my running form?
Experts recommend taking at least a few minutes to familiarize yourself with running on a treadmill.
Unlike outdoor runs where you’re propelling yourself off the ground, the belt is moving under you on a treadmill, said Andrew Schille, a clinical research coordinator at the Emory University Sports Performance and Research Center.
People who are not accustomed to treadmill running may adopt a slightly higher step frequency and land a bit more toward the front of their foot compared with the heel of their foot, Van Hooren said.
